Water is the most precious resource in East African agriculture. Drip irrigation represents a revolution in how we manage this resource, offering significant benefits over traditional flood or sprinkler methods. For Somali farmers facing climate variability and water scarcity, drip systems provide a sustainable path to increased productivity and food security.

Water Efficiency & Conservation

Drip systems deliver water directly to the root zone, reducing evaporation and runoff by up to 50-60%. This precision irrigation allows farmers to expand their cultivated area even with limited water supplies. In Somalia's arid regions, this efficiency translates to more reliable harvests during dry seasons and reduced dependency on unpredictable rainfall patterns.

Enhanced Crop Quality & Yield

Consistent moisture levels prevent the stress that leads to fruit cracking and blossom end rot, resulting in more uniform and marketable produce. Drip irrigation enables precise nutrient delivery through fertigation, ensuring optimal plant nutrition throughout the growing cycle. Farmers report yield increases of 20-40% when transitioning from traditional irrigation methods.

Weed Suppression & Labor Savings

Because water is only applied where it's needed, the spaces between rows remain dry, which significantly inhibits the growth of weeds and reduces the labor required for weeding. This targeted approach also minimizes soil erosion and preserves beneficial soil microorganisms in the root zone.

Climate Resilience

Drip irrigation systems are particularly valuable during Somalia's extended dry periods. By maintaining consistent soil moisture, crops can continue growing even when rainfall is scarce. Combined with solar-powered pumping solutions, drip systems provide energy-efficient water management that's independent of grid electricity.

Economic Benefits

While the initial investment in drip infrastructure requires capital, the long-term savings in water, labor, and fertilizer costs typically result in payback periods of 2-3 seasons. Higher yields and improved crop quality command better market prices, making drip irrigation a sound investment for commercial vegetable producers.
